Before officially introducing Volkswagen's IQ.Drive, let's briefly introduce the composition of the automatic driving assistance system, in principle, all the automatic driving assistance systems currently on the market can be divided into three parts, namely perception - decision - execution.

Perception corresponds to sensors, such as ultrasonic radar, millimeter wave radar, lidar, etc.; decision-making corresponds to processors, such as Tesla's FSD, Mobileye EyeQ4, black sesame's Huashan No. 1 A500; execution can be understood as our operating mechanism, such as steering, braking, throttle, etc.

Back to the Volkswagen IQ.Drive, this system is a typical L2 level of automatic driving system, from the sensor point of view, IQ.Drive has 1 front view camera (in-car mirror position), 4 panoramic cameras (one front and one rear and both side mirrors), 3 millimeter wave radar (front, left rear, right rear), 12 ultrasonic radar (left front, right front, left rear, right rear two).

Based on this hardware and software conditions, Volkswagen IQ.Drive has several core functions, which we explain one by one:

The first is the Travel Assist full-speed domain driver assistance system, which is actually a collection of functions, including ACC advanced adaptive cruise system, Front Assist front anti-collision active braking system, Side Assist lane change assist system, active braking and other functions, can achieve full speed domain lateral and longitudinal control.

IQ. Can Drive support Volkswagen's ambitions in the field of autonomous driving?

In terms of segmentation, the ACC Adaptive Cruise System uses a front-view camera and millimeter-wave radar to follow the vehicle in front (0-180km/h) with a Stop &Go automatic follow-up function.

IQ. Can Drive support Volkswagen's ambitions in the field of autonomous driving?

LKA lane keeping is to identify the lane line through the camera, if the vehicle is detected to deviate or is about to deviate, the system applies a torque to the steering mechanism according to the speed and offset, so that the vehicle is centered.

IQ. Can Drive support Volkswagen's ambitions in the field of autonomous driving?

SWA lane change assist is easy to understand, the use of two millimeter wave radar on the rear bumper to detect the rear of the car, when the speed is greater than 15km / h, the rear of the car, the rearview mirror will light up the warning light to remind the driver.

The PLA 3.0 intelligent parking system uses a fusion solution of vision sensors and ultrasonic radar, which can identify both marked and non-marking parking spaces. (If the ultrasonic radar scheme alone is used, the empty marked parking spaces cannot be recognized).)

We focus on the effect after opening, first of all, the most commonly used adaptive cruise, in the high-speed section, the system performance is more eye-catching, the ability to drive in the center is stable (the curve with large curvature has not been tested), and the acceleration and deceleration rate when following the car can make the driver and occupants feel more comfortable and can greatly reduce fatigue.

In the urban section, the general scene can be very good, but at a relatively high speed through some curves with large curves IQ.Drive will automatically exit, which should be a protection mechanism, the system's ability to execute the scene is insufficient; another thing that impresses us is that iq.Drive will exit when passing through traffic light intersections without markings, but once the lane line is newly identified, it can also be automatically activated.

IQ. Can Drive support Volkswagen's ambitions in the field of autonomous driving?

In a more concerned about the problem of hand off, we have not carried out a specific test, but at least can let go for more than 20 seconds, once the set time to get out of the hand after the system will have a reminder including text, progressive long sound, icons and so on.

In addition, its way of lifting the alarm can also give praise, compared to the torque sensor used by Tesla and other models, the capacitive sensor used in the Volkswagen ID.4 CROZZ (note that not all models equipped with IQ.Drive are capacitive sensors). The advantage of using a capacitive sensor solution is that you don't have to worry about the dilemma of "the direction is small and can't get out of the warning, and the direction is too large to affect the body attitude", you only need to hold the steering wheel with your hand to lift the alarm.

First of all, from the hardware side, Tesla AutoPilot (AP HW 3.0 version) has 9 cameras (1 front-view tri-eye, 4 surround view, 1 car (only Model 3 is equipped), 1 rear camera), 12 ultrasonic radar, 1 millimeter wave radar; and the ADiGO3.0 complete system includes 12 ultrasonic radar, 5 millimeter wave radar, 4 panoramic cameras, 1 in-car driver monitoring camera, 1 front-view camera (Mobileye). EyeQ4 chip solution) plus ADAS high-definition map.

Ps: The current North American version of the Model 3 became a thoroughly visual route, eliminating radar.

In terms of horizontal comparison, in terms of hardware, GAC Aean's ADiGO 3.0 advantage is more obvious, the number of millimeter wave radar is more, and the ADAS high-precision map is also the only one in the field, but they are not equipped with lidar.
